Why Atlanta Is a Major Convention Destination
Atlanta works because of scale, access, and convenience. First, it is easy to fly into Atlanta. Hartsfield Jackson is one of the busiest airports in the world, with many direct flights. That makes it easier for national groups to get people in and out.
Second, Atlanta has a strong downtown convention core. The Georgia World Congress Center sits near Mercedes Benz Stadium and Centennial Olympic Park, so attendees can walk to food, attractions, and entertainment. Third, Atlanta has a deep hotel supply in multiple areas like Downtown, Buckhead, Cumberland, and the airport corridor.
Georgia World Congress Center (GWCC)

Location: 285 Andrew Young International Blvd NW, Atlanta, GA 30313
Area: Downtown
The Georgia World Congress Center is the biggest convention center in Atlanta and one of the largest in the world. It is built for very large shows and high attendance events.
- About 3.9 million square feet total facility size
- About 1.4 to 1.5 million square feet of exhibit space
- 12 exhibit halls
- 100 plus meeting rooms
- 2 ballrooms
- 3 auditoriums
One big advantage is the campus. GWCC sits on a large convention and entertainment district with Mercedes Benz Stadium and Centennial Olympic Park. This makes it easier to plan big events with strong attendee experiences.
Another advantage is sustainability. GWCC is LEED Gold certified. If your company tracks ESG goals, a venue with sustainability credentials can support your event story and internal reporting.
Best for: Mega conventions, national trade shows, consumer expos, and events that can exceed 10,000 attendees.
Nearby planning angle: Downtown hotels, dining, and attractions help you sell the destination. Many attendees can walk instead of relying on shuttles.
Atlanta Convention Center at AmericasMart
Area: Downtown, integrated with the AmericasMart campus
The Atlanta Convention Center at AmericasMart is a strong downtown option for mid size conferences and trade shows. It is connected to major attractions and has good hotel access.
- About 500,000 square feet total event space
- About 100,000 square feet of contiguous exhibit space
- 35 plus breakout rooms
A big benefit is convenience. The venue has direct access to on site hotels like the Westin and Hotel Indigo, with more than 1,300 rooms combined. That reduces transportation headaches and helps planners keep everything tight.
Best for: Markets, trade shows, corporate events, and mid large conferences that want downtown energy without GWCC scale.
Nearby planning angle: Centennial Olympic Park, downtown restaurants, and walkable attractions help increase attendee satisfaction.
Cobb Galleria Centre and Cumberland Area Convention Options
Location: 2 Galleria Pkwy SE, Atlanta, GA 30339
Area: Cumberland and Vinings
The Cobb Galleria Centre is a major regional convention venue in the Cumberland area. It is often listed as Cobb Galleria Centre or Cobb Convention Center. It is connected to the Renaissance Atlanta Waverly Hotel and Convention Center, which helps planners keep meetings and rooms close together.
This area is attractive because it is easier for local and regional attendees to drive in. It also has strong access from I 75 and I 285. Another bonus is that it is near The Battery and Truist Park, which gives attendees more entertainment options after sessions.
Best for: Regional conventions, corporate events, leadership meetings, and events where parking and highway access matter.
Airport Area: Georgia International Convention Center (GICC)
Location: 2000 Convention Center Concourse, College Park, GA 30337
Area: Airport and College Park
The Georgia International Convention Center is the main airport area convention facility serving the Atlanta airport corridor. If your event has a high percentage of fly in attendees, this location can save time and reduce stress.
Airport area venues are often chosen for short programs, national meetings, and events where people arrive and leave quickly. If you want simple travel logistics, this is a strong option.
Best for: Airport adjacent national meetings, aviation or airline events, and conferences designed for fast arrival and fast departure.
Hotel Based Convention Centers in Atlanta
Sometimes you do not need a standalone convention center. A large meeting hotel can be the better choice when you want everything under one roof, especially for smaller conferences.
Atlanta Marriott Marquis
The Atlanta Marriott Marquis is a large downtown convention hotel with about 169,000 square feet of meeting space. It works well for conferences that want a single host property with meeting rooms, ballrooms, and guest rooms in one place.
Best for: 800 to 2,000 person conferences, corporate meetings, and association programs that do not require a huge exhibit floor.
Atlanta Marriott Buckhead Hotel & Conference Center
The Atlanta Marriott Buckhead Hotel & Conference Center is a smaller, more executive style option in Buckhead with about 30,000 square feet of meeting space. Buckhead can feel more upscale and is often chosen for leadership groups.
Best for: Executive retreats, board meetings, leadership sessions, and smaller conferences that want a premium feel.
When to Choose a Hotel Venue vs a Convention Center
Choose a hotel venue when you want simple logistics, a tight room block, and a more contained event experience. Choose a standalone convention center when you need large contiguous exhibit space, multiple halls, and very high attendance capacity.

How to Choose the Right Convention Center in Atlanta
Start with your event size. If you expect 10,000 plus attendees with a huge exhibit floor, the Georgia World Congress Center is built for that. If you expect 500 to 3,000 people, you may get a better fit at AmericasMart, Cobb Galleria, GICC, or a large convention hotel.
Next, look at layout needs. Some shows need one big contiguous space. Others can work across smaller halls and breakout rooms. Then consider location. Downtown gives you walkability and attractions. Cumberland gives you parking and highway access. The airport area gives you fast travel logistics.

Frequently Asked Questions About Atlanta Convention Centers
What is the largest convention center in Atlanta?
The Georgia World Congress Center is the largest. It offers about 1.4 to 1.5 million square feet of exhibit space across 12 exhibit halls.
Which Atlanta convention center is closest to the airport?
The Georgia International Convention Center in College Park is the main airport area convention facility serving the Atlanta airport corridor.
Which venues offer on site hotels?
AmericasMart has direct access to the Westin and Hotel Indigo. Cobb Galleria connects to the Renaissance Atlanta Waverly. Large convention hotels like the Atlanta Marriott Marquis also offer major meeting space under one roof.
What is the best option for a 500 person tech conference?
For 500 attendees, a large hotel venue, Cobb Galleria, or the Georgia International Convention Center can be a strong fit, depending on your audience travel pattern and breakout needs.
What is the best option for a 20,000 attendee trade show?
The Georgia World Congress Center is the best fit for very large trade shows due to its exhibit capacity and number of halls.
